Transaction 62703bd546ab292063325ae5550e07e6c41789c47cefb2d7f983e8a8721e3507
1 Input
1 Output
-
62703bd546ab292063325ae5550e07e6c41789c47cefb2d7f983e8a8721e3507:0
- value
- 378549
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 687a89e75567e0c644d67130ee10b2c39a17f6a3 OP_EQUAL
- address
- 3BDSzdZvJFrFHkjqmE8GaCGSbLDt57or9G